Увод у ХТМЛ кодирање УРЛ адреса

У овом ћемо чланку детаљно сазнати о ХТМЛ кодирању УРЛ адреса. ХТМЛ УРЛ је акроним Униформ Ресоурце Лоцатор-а до глобалне или ИП адресе на Ворлд Виде Вебу. Веб сервер добија страницу користећи УРЛ за веб претраживач.

Пример: хттпс : //ввв.гоогле.цом је један од УРЛ адреса.

АСЦИИ сет знакова важан је за кодирање ХТМЛ УРЛ адреса. УРЛ се шаље на Интернет користећи АСЦИИ сет знакова. Не-АСЦИИ знак је ограничен јер могу створити сукоб да пронађу пут странице до сервера. Због овог проблема, ХТМЛ користи УРЛ кодирање.

ХТМЛ кодирање УРЛ адресе, претворите знак који није АСЦИИ у формат који може послати на Интернет. Корисници се могу претворити помоћу „%“ да би наставили са двије хексадецималне цифре.

Како извести кодирање УРЛ-а у ХТМЛ-у?

  • ХТМЛ језик креира УРЛ користећи атрибут таг и хреф. На пример . ако направите било коју веб локацију и желите да пређете једну страницу на другу, онда напишите назив датотеке. .
  • Неки знакови су ограничени на име веб адресе због стварања сукоба, а не-АСЦИИ знак се замењује са „%“ да би наставили са две шестерокутне цифре.
  • УРЛ не садржи простор. Заузима место знака плус (+) или% 20. У облику ХТМЛ странице дошло је до размака у излазу текста „инпут“, затим плус знака. Индиректно се налазило место у називу УРЛ-а, а затим се приказује% 20
  • УРЛ ознака садржи велика слова (А-З) и мала слова (а- з), децималне цифре (1-9) и неке посебне знакове.

Ако убацим размак, УРЛ кодирање долази као ХТМЛ + ЦСС.

У било којем УРЛ-у, ако дамо простор, кодирање УРЛ-а ће се појавити као мој% 20филе.хтмл.

  1. Резервисани карактери: Постоје неки знакови који имају неко значење у адреси УРЛ-а и ми можемо користити сврху именовања. Можемо користити оба начина, као што је знак плус (/) који се користи за одвојени део УРЛ-а, другу руку коју можемо / кодирати по% 2ф, без значења у имену адресе.
  2. Небезбедни ликови: Много знакова долази са много неразумевања у УРЛ адреси као што је размак у називу УРЛ-а. Уместо да заузмете простор у називу УРЛ адресе, напишите. тада се назив УРЛ-а чини „па ге.хтмл“.
  3. Контролни знакови који нису АСЦИИ: Ови знакови укључују скуп хексачке вредности од 80 Фф коју је потребно претворити у формат.
  4. АСЦИИ контролни знакови: Унутар УРЛ-а не ради.

Примери кодирања ХТМЛ УРЛ адреса

Следе примери ХТМЛ кодирања УРЛ адреса детаљно објашњени:

1. Резервирање знакова кодирања

Следи табела која се користи за кодирање резервисаних знакова.

Ликови$&+,/:;=?@
УРЛ код24%26%% 2б% 2ц% 2ф% 3а% 3б% 3д% 3ф40%

2. Небезбедни ликови

Следи табела која се користи за кодирање несигурних ликова.

Ликовипростора<>#%()|\^~()
УРЛ код20%22%% 3ц% 3е23%25%% 7б% 7д% 7ц% 5ц% 5е% 7е% 5б% 5д

3. Контролни знак који није АСЦИИ

Следи Табела која се користи за кодирање знакова који нису АСЦИИ.

ЦхарацтерУРЛ кодЦхарацтерУРЛ кодЦхарацтерУРЛ кодЦхарацтерУРЛ код
% 80˜% 98«% аб¿% бф
% 82% 99% ацА% ц0
ƒ% 83ш% 9аª% ааА% ц1
% 84% 9б®% аеА% ц2
% 85œ% 9ц¯% афА% ц3
% 86% 9д°% б0А% ц4
% 87ж% 9е±% б1А% ц5
ˆ% 88Ы% 9ф²% б2Ӕ% в6
% 89×% д7³% б3Ц% ц7
Ш% 8а¡% а1´% б4Е% ц8
% 8б¢% а2µ% б5Е% ц9
Œ% 8ц£% а3% б6Е% ца
Ж% 8е¤% а4·% б7Е% цб
'% 91¥% а5¸% б8И% цц
'% 92¦% а6¹% б9И% цд
% 93§% а7º% баИ% це
% 94¨% а8»% ббИ% цф
% 95©% а9¼%пре нове ереÐ% д0
-% 96-% 97½% бдН% д1
а% е3Þ% де¾% битиО% д2
ӕ% е6ß% дфØ% д8О% д3
а% е4а% е0Ы% ддО% д4

4. АСЦИИ контролни знакови

Слиједи Табела која се користи за кодирање Асции знакова.

АСЦИИ ЦхарацтерУРЛ кодирање
НУЛ - нулл знак% 00
СОХ - почетак заглавља% 01
СТКС - почетак текста% 02
ЕТКС - крај текста% 03
ЕОТ - крај преноса% 04
ЕНК - упит% 05
АЦК - признати% 06
БЕЛ - звоно% 07
БС - повратни простор% 08
ХТ - хоризонтална картица% 09
ЛФ-лине феед% 0А
ВТ- вертикални језичак% 0Б
Феед у облику ФФ% 0Ц
Повратак ЦР-кочије% 0Д
СО- пребаци напоље% 0Е
СИ - померање% 0Ф
ДЛЕ - излаз за везу података% 10
ДЦ1 - контрола уређаја 1% 11
ДЦ2 - управљање уређајем 2% 12
ДЦ3 - контрола уређаја 3% 13
ДЦ4 - управљање уређајем 4% 14
НАК- негативно признавање% 15
СИН- синхронизовати% 16
ЕТБ - крајњи блок преноса% 17
ЦАН - отказати% 18
ЕМ - крај средњег% 19
СУБ - супститут% 1А
ЕСЦ-есцапе% 1Б
ФС сепаратор датотека% 1Ц
Сепаратор ГС- групе% 1Д
РС-сепаратор записа% 1Е
УС сепаратор јединица% 1Ф

Важност кодирања УРЛ-ова у ХТМЛ-у

Ако је УРЛ резервисан, несигурни и нису АСЦИИ карактери, онда УРЛ адреса постаје компликованија и није разумљива. Када веб прегледач претражује УРЛ адресе, веб сервер претражује име или путању УРЛ адресе. Ако назив УРЛ-а није АСЦИИ, тешко је да нађете УРЛ важност кодирања УРЛ-а у ХТМЛ-у.

УРЛ адреса мора бити лака за проналажење, универзално прихваћена и разумљива за све веб прегледаче као и за веб сервер. неки знакови праве неспоразуме у УРЛ-у јер се користе у неку сврху ако се не користе у било коју сврху. тада се могло догодити сукоб и пут не стигне до корисника.

Да бисте савладали све потешкоће и олакшали кориснику знакове који нису АСЦИИ претварани у АСЦИИ код користећи% да бисте добили два хексадецимална броја.

Закључак

Кодирање УРЛ-ова у ХТМЛ-у зна како претворити скуп знакова који нису АСЦИИ у ваљани АСЦИИ скуп формата. Универзално је прихваћен и веб претраживач ради без грешке. Кодирање УРЛ адреса може се покренути лако и сигурно. Да би се избегао сукоб именовања и сврха именовања кодирања УРЛ-ова неопходна је.

Препоручени чланци

Ово је водич за кодирање ХТМЛ УРЛ адреса. Овде смо расправљали о уводном ХТМЛ УРЛ-у и како извести кодирање УРЛ-а у ХТМЛ-у заједно са његовим примерима и важношћу. Такође можете погледати следеће чланке да бисте сазнали више -

  1. Различите врсте оквира у ХТМЛ-у
  2. Топ 3 атрибута текстуалне везе у ХТМЛ-у
  3. ХТМЛ команде (основне, средње, напредне)
  4. ХТМЛ5 елементи - ознаке и примери
  5. Наставите рад са изјавама на Ц # са примерима

Категорија: